If you're around the French Quarter, there is a small, free museum housed upstairs in Arnaud's restaurant on Bienville Street. (Go in the restaurant and ask the maitre di the way tot he museum). The museum contains Ms. Wells costumes from when she presided as queen over 22 Mardis Gras balls held between the late 1930s and early 1960s.
